About Cotton

Meet Cotton, a playful Great Pyrenees who’s eager to find her forever home. She’s already impressing everyone with her big personality and sweet disposition. Cotton adores her toys, especially the floppy ones she can toss and chase around. While she loves playing with other dogs, she’s respectful of their space when they're done. If you have a canine buddy at home, Cotton would thrive alongside them. Fascinated by cats, she enjoys their company but doesn’t require them to be happy. Cotton’s foster mom notes that she’s a smart girl, already knowing commands like sit, stay, and down. She’s also spayed and up to date on vaccinations, showing great potential as a loyal companion. One thing to keep in mind is Cotton's playful nature around chickens; she sees them as fluffy toys. Ideally, she should go to a home without them. As a Great Pyrenees, Cotton likes to have space to roam and would do best in a home with a fenced yard where she can keep an eye on her loved ones.
